Anything with LPS, especially linear SLI/H  8)
We have now got a 140W SLI/H lamp, and the gear to run it is on order and should be here in the next few days.  ;D

This was the first type of lamp to be used for motorway lighting in the UK. 1200 of them were installed on the M1 between London and Luton in 1971.

If I owned a city  - and a supply of vintage lights to install, I might do something like this:

-Large cobra heads or clamshells for highways (GE M1000, Westinghouse OV-50 etc), 1000w MH or mercury 
-Clamshells (Westinghouse OV-20,  GE Form 400, etc), 400w mercury or MH for arterials
-Fluorescent VHO (Whiteway, GE, etc) with Powergroove lamps for the Main Street.
-Post top acorns and pole mount gum balls, CMH 3000K lamps, for residential streets
-NEMA mercury fixtures for utility/area lighting
-SOX fixtures with drop lenses for the outskirts of town and bridges
HPS floods to light building facades. Clear mercury floods to uplight trees. T12 4100K fluorescents to light signs.

Not a big fan of ballast-in-arm/power bracket fixtures or radial waves.  Cobra heads would be fine but I like remote ballast clamshells better.
